Transaction 34cf59239c98916996a3567e1a5f87f1dd8efca4e4728e55b053fff5553c83fa

2 Input
2 Outputs
  • 34cf59239c98916996a3567e1a5f87f1dd8efca4e4728e55b053fff5553c83fa:0
  • value  1011580
    address  1Bef7mRWk22grvVhNDRuEJXgPregmzhQch
  • 34cf59239c98916996a3567e1a5f87f1dd8efca4e4728e55b053fff5553c83fa:1
  • value  5550327
    address  326ranekm52yU9m8JFHQSSLWbTH23pEPSv